Perspective is everything! Such is the case with us too.
 
Most of us have a default perspective we use to define ourselves. We may rely on our roles, status, job, intellect, or even our problems to tell ourselves “who we are.” If you were to meet a likeable stranger on a plane who asked you, “So _____, tell me who you are in two sentences or less,” what would you say? 
 
Look Down- Read Ephesians 1:3-10

Together, make a list on the left side of a sheet of paper of everything in these verses that God says He intends for His people. (8-10 blessings)

Look Out

Using your above list, create a second list on the right of items that might be the opposites of those blessings. For example, God’s word says we are blameless. The opposite is deserving of shame.

Look at the two lists your group made together. When you think about the church in general and believers you know, which list do you believe is more characteristic of the way we view ourselves?
 
Look In

Which pair of opposites speaks to you today? How do you sense God might be inviting you to experience Him more fully? How do you think He might be encouraging you to adopt a more accurate perspective of yourself?
